如何恢复刷机应用数据库

如何恢复刷机应用数据库

如何恢复刷机应用数据库

恢复刷机应用数据库可能涉及几个关键步骤:备份数据、使用恢复工具、手动修复数据库、寻求专业帮助。备份数据是最重要的一步,可以避免数据的永久丢失。下面我们将详细讨论如何备份数据以最大程度地保护数据安全。

一、备份数据

在刷机前,最关键的一步是备份数据。备份不仅可以确保在刷机失败或出现问题时数据不会丢失,还能帮助在恢复数据库时提供一个安全的基础。

1、使用内置备份工具

大多数智能手机操作系统,如Android和iOS,都提供内置的备份工具。Android用户可以使用Google Drive进行备份,而iOS用户可以利用iCloud。

  • Google Drive:在Android设备上,进入设置 > 系统 > 备份,确保“备份到Google Drive”已启用。系统会自动备份应用数据、联系人、设置等。
  • iCloud:在iOS设备上,进入设置 > 用户名 > iCloud > iCloud备份,确保“iCloud备份”已启用。

2、使用第三方备份工具

如果内置备份工具无法满足需求,还可以使用第三方备份工具。例如:

  • Titanium Backup:适用于Android设备,需要root权限,支持备份和恢复应用及其数据。
  • Helium:适用于Android设备,无需root权限,支持备份应用数据到云端或本地存储。

二、使用恢复工具

如果在刷机过程中数据丢失,可以使用一些恢复工具来尝试恢复数据。以下是几个常用的恢复工具及其使用方法:

1、DiskDigger

DiskDigger是一款强大的数据恢复工具,适用于Android设备。可以用来恢复误删的照片、文档等。

  • 下载并安装DiskDigger应用。
  • 打开应用并授予root权限(如有)。
  • 选择要扫描的存储设备(内存或SD卡)。
  • 选择文件类型,开始扫描。
  • 扫描完成后,选择要恢复的文件并保存。

2、EaseUS MobiSaver

EaseUS MobiSaver是一款适用于Android和iOS设备的恢复工具,可以恢复丢失的照片、联系人、消息等。

  • 下载并安装EaseUS MobiSaver应用。
  • 打开应用并连接设备到电脑。
  • 选择扫描模式(快速扫描或深度扫描)。
  • 扫描完成后,选择要恢复的文件并保存。

三、手动修复数据库

在某些情况下,可能需要手动修复刷机后的数据库。这通常涉及一些技术步骤,如使用ADB命令、修复SQL数据库等。

1、使用ADB命令

ADB(Android Debug Bridge)是一种强大的命令行工具,可以用来与Android设备进行通信。可以使用ADB命令来备份和恢复数据库。

  • 下载并安装ADB工具包。
  • 在电脑上打开命令提示符或终端。
  • 输入以下命令连接设备:
    adb devices

  • 输入以下命令备份数据库:
    adb backup -f /path/to/backup/backup.ab -apk -shared -all

  • 输入以下命令恢复数据库:
    adb restore /path/to/backup/backup.ab

2、修复SQL数据库

如果刷机应用的数据库是一个SQL数据库(如SQLite),可能需要手动修复数据库文件。

  • 下载并安装SQLite工具。
  • 使用SQLite工具打开损坏的数据库文件。
  • 执行以下SQL命令尝试修复数据库:
    PRAGMA integrity_check;

    PRAGMA quick_check;

  • 如果检测到错误,尝试导出数据并重新导入到一个新的数据库文件。

四、寻求专业帮助

如果以上方法无法恢复数据库,可能需要寻求专业帮助。例如,联系设备制造商或专业的数据恢复公司。

1、联系设备制造商

设备制造商通常提供技术支持和服务,可以帮助解决刷机过程中遇到的问题。

  • 访问设备制造商的官方网站。
  • 查找技术支持或客户服务的联系方式。
  • 提供设备信息和问题描述,寻求帮助。

2、专业数据恢复公司

专业的数据恢复公司拥有先进的技术和设备,可以恢复大多数情况下的数据丢失问题。

  • 搜索并联系当地或在线的数据恢复公司。
  • 提供设备信息和问题描述,获取报价和服务详情。
  • 将设备寄送到数据恢复公司,等待数据恢复结果。

五、预防措施

为了避免在未来遇到类似问题,可以采取一些预防措施。

1、定期备份

定期备份数据是最有效的预防措施。可以设置自动备份,确保数据始终有最新的备份。

  • 使用内置备份工具设置自动备份。
  • 使用第三方备份工具设置定期备份计划。

2、谨慎刷机

在刷机前,务必确保已经备份好所有重要数据,并仔细阅读刷机教程和注意事项。

  • 选择可靠的刷机ROM和工具。
  • 确保设备电量充足,避免刷机过程中断电。

3、使用项目管理系统

如果是团队协作项目,推荐使用项目管理系统,如研发项目管理系统PingCode通用项目协作软件Worktile。这些系统可以帮助团队高效管理项目,避免数据丢失。

  • PingCode:适用于研发项目管理,提供敏捷开发、缺陷管理、需求管理等功能。
  • Worktile:适用于通用项目协作,提供任务管理、文档管理、团队沟通等功能。

通过以上方法,可以有效地恢复刷机应用数据库,并采取预防措施,避免未来的数据丢失问题。

相关问答FAQs:

1. 什么是刷机应用数据库?
刷机应用数据库是一个存储着各种刷机应用程序和相关数据的集合,它可以让您在手机上安装和管理各种刷机软件,以实现手机系统的定制化和个性化。

2. 我的刷机应用数据库丢失了,如何恢复它?
如果您的刷机应用数据库丢失了,可以尝试以下几种方法来恢复它:

  • 检查手机备份:如果您有备份手机的习惯,可以尝试从手机备份中还原刷机应用数据库。
  • 使用第三方工具:有一些第三方工具可以帮助您恢复刷机应用数据库。您可以搜索并尝试一些备受好评的工具,如"刷机应用数据库恢复工具"。
  • 重新下载刷机应用:如果您无法找回刷机应用数据库,可以尝试重新下载和安装您需要的刷机应用程序。

3. 如何避免刷机应用数据库丢失?
要避免刷机应用数据库丢失,可以采取以下措施:

  • 定期备份:定期备份手机中的刷机应用数据库,以便在需要时能够恢复。
  • 注意安装来源:仅从可信赖的应用商店或官方网站下载和安装刷机应用程序,以避免下载到病毒或恶意软件。
  • 更新软件:及时更新刷机应用程序和手机系统,以确保它们具有最新的安全性和稳定性。

希望以上解答对您有所帮助!如果还有其他问题,请随时提问。

文章包含AI辅助创作,作者:Edit2,如若转载,请注明出处:https://docs.pingcode.com/baike/1900422

(0)
Edit2Edit2
免费注册
电话联系

4008001024

微信咨询
微信咨询
返回顶部